A chemiluminescence sensor for cyanide combined with a flow-injection system is presented in this paper. Based on the chemiluminescence reaction of luminol immobilized on Amberlyst A-27 anion-exchange resin and copper ion immobilized on D151 large-pore cation-exchange resin with CN- in alkaline solution, the sensor can be used for CN- monitoring with a wide linear range, high sensitivity as well as simplicity of instrumentation. The sensor response to the concentration of cyanide is linear in the range of 5.0 x 10(-9) to 2.0 x 10(-6) g ml(-1) with a relative standard deviation of < 5% (n = 7). The detection limit is 2.0 x 10(-9) g ml(-1). The results can be obtained within 1 min for each measurement. The column with immobilized chemiluminescence reagents can be used 200 times. The sensor has been used for CN- monitoring in tap water and industrial waste water; the results are consistent with those obtained by an established chemiluminescence method.
